WOD: Teams of 3 👇
250 Cal Assault Bike
*Every change alt between
- 8 Burpee box steps
- 12 DB push ups
250 Cal ski-erg
*Every change alt between
- 10 S/A DB snatches
- 10 V-ups
250 Cal Row
*Every change alternate between
- 10 DB push press
- 10 DB lunges
*Aim for 1 minute max cals and change.
